本文目录导读:
数据仓库作为企业信息化的核心基础设施,已经成为企业竞争的重要武器,本文将基于数据仓库技术教程课后答案,从数据仓库的概念、构建、应用等方面进行深入浅出地解析,帮助读者全面了解数据仓库技术。
数据仓库的概念
数据仓库是一个面向主题、集成的、非易失的、支持数据查询和分析的数据集合,它将分散在各个业务系统中的数据,按照一定的规则进行整合、清洗、转换和存储,为企业的决策提供支持。
1、面向主题:数据仓库按照企业的业务主题进行组织,如销售、财务、人力资源等,便于用户从特定角度进行分析。
图片来源于网络,如有侵权联系删除
2、集成的:数据仓库将各个业务系统中的数据进行整合,消除数据孤岛,提高数据的一致性和准确性。
3、非易失的:数据仓库中的数据一旦被写入,除非进行数据删除操作,否则不会发生变化,保证数据的完整性和可靠性。
4、支持数据查询和分析:数据仓库提供丰富的查询和分析功能,支持用户从不同角度、不同层次进行数据挖掘和决策支持。
数据仓库的构建
1、需求分析:在构建数据仓库之前,首先要明确企业的业务需求,确定数据仓库的主题、功能、性能等指标。
2、数据模型设计:根据需求分析,设计数据仓库的数据模型,包括实体、属性、关系等,为数据仓库的构建提供基础。
图片来源于网络,如有侵权联系删除
3、数据抽取、清洗和转换:从各个业务系统中抽取数据,进行数据清洗、转换和加载,确保数据的质量和一致性。
4、数据存储:将处理后的数据存储在数据仓库中,可以选择关系型数据库、NoSQL数据库或分布式文件系统等存储方式。
5、数据索引和优化:为数据仓库中的数据进行索引,提高查询效率,根据业务需求对数据仓库进行优化,如分区、分片等。
6、数据安全与权限管理:确保数据仓库中的数据安全,对用户进行权限管理,防止数据泄露和滥用。
数据仓库的应用
1、决策支持:数据仓库为企业的决策提供数据支持,帮助企业发现业务规律、优化资源配置、提高运营效率。
图片来源于网络,如有侵权联系删除
2、数据挖掘:利用数据仓库中的数据,进行数据挖掘,发现潜在的业务机会、市场趋势等。
3、数据可视化:通过数据可视化技术,将数据仓库中的数据以图表、报表等形式展示,便于用户直观地了解业务状况。
4、实时数据仓库:结合实时数据技术,构建实时数据仓库,为企业提供实时的业务洞察。
数据仓库技术在企业发展中具有重要作用,本文从数据仓库的概念、构建、应用等方面进行了详细解析,在实际应用中,企业应根据自身业务需求,选择合适的数据仓库技术,实现数据资产的充分利用,为企业创造价值。
标签: #数据仓库技术教程
评论列表